How does CUDA mining compare to other mining algorithms for digital currencies?
Can you explain how CUDA mining compares to other mining algorithms for digital currencies? What are the advantages and disadvantages of using CUDA mining? How does it differ from other popular mining algorithms?
4 answers
- Slattery SawyerOct 14, 2025 · 5 months agoCUDA mining is a mining algorithm that utilizes the power of NVIDIA graphics processing units (GPUs) to mine digital currencies. Compared to other mining algorithms, such as CPU mining and ASIC mining, CUDA mining offers several advantages. Firstly, GPUs are generally more powerful and efficient than CPUs, allowing for faster and more efficient mining. Secondly, CUDA mining allows for parallel processing, which means that multiple calculations can be performed simultaneously, further increasing mining speed. However, there are also some downsides to CUDA mining. GPUs can be expensive and consume a significant amount of electricity, resulting in higher mining costs. Additionally, CUDA mining is not suitable for all digital currencies, as some cryptocurrencies are specifically designed to be resistant to GPU mining. Overall, CUDA mining can be a profitable option for mining certain digital currencies, but it's important to consider the costs and limitations involved.
